婷婷综合国产,91蜜桃婷婷狠狠久久综合9色 ,九九九九九精品,国产综合av

主頁 > 知識庫 > Go語言中字符串的查找方法小結

Go語言中字符串的查找方法小結

熱門標簽:最短的地圖標注 ?兓? 電梯外呼訪客系統 成都呼叫中心外呼系統平臺 浙江人工智能外呼管理系統 谷歌便利店地圖標注 騰訊外呼系統價格 百度地圖標注搜索關鍵詞 電銷機器人可以補救房產中介嗎

1.func Contains(s, substr string) bool這個函數是查找某個字符是否在這個字符串中存在,存在返回true

復制代碼 代碼如下:

import (
 "fmt"
 "strings"
)

func main() {
 fmt.Println(strings.Contains("widuu", "wi")) //true
 fmt.Println(strings.Contains("wi", "widuu")) //false
}


2.func ContainsAny(s, chars string) bool這個是查詢字符串中是否包含多個字符

復制代碼 代碼如下:

import (
 "fmt"
 "strings"
)

func main() {
 fmt.Println(strings.ContainsAny("widuu", "wd")) //true
}


3.func ContainsRune(s string, r rune) bool,這里邊當然是字符串中是否包含rune類型,其中rune類型是utf8.RUneCountString可以完整表示全部Unicode字符的類型

復制代碼 代碼如下:

import (
 "fmt"
 "strings"
)

func main() {
 fmt.Println(strings.ContainsRune("widuu", rune('w'))) //true
 fmt.Println(strings.ContainsRune("widuu", 20))        //fasle
}


4.func Count(s, sep string) int這個的作用就是輸出,在一段字符串中有多少匹配到的字符

復制代碼 代碼如下:

import (
 "fmt"
 "strings"
)

func main() {
 fmt.Println(strings.Count("widuu", "uu")) //1
 fmt.Println(strings.Count("widuu", "u"))  //2
}

5.func Index(s, sep string) int 這個函數是查找字符串,然后返回當前的位置,輸入的都是string類型,然后int的位置信息

復制代碼 代碼如下:

import (
 "fmt"
 "strings"
)

func main() {
 fmt.Println(strings.Index("widuu", "i")) //1
 fmt.Println(strings.Index("widuu", "u")) //3
}


6.func IndexAny(s, chars string) int 這個函數是一樣的查找,字符串第一次出現的位置,如果不存在就返回-1

復制代碼 代碼如下:

import (
 "fmt"
 "strings"
)

func main() {
 fmt.Println(strings.IndexAny("widuu", "u")) //3
}


7.func IndexByte(s string, c byte) int,這個函數功能還是查找第一次粗線的位置,只不過這次C是byte類型的,查找到返回位置,找不到返回-1

復制代碼 代碼如下:

import (
 "fmt"
 "strings"
)

func main() {
 fmt.Println(strings.IndexByte("hello xiaowei", 'x')) //6
}


8.func IndexRune(s string, r rune) int,還是查找位置,只不過這次是rune類型的

復制代碼 代碼如下:

import (
 "fmt"
 "strings"
)

func main() {
 fmt.Println(strings.IndexRune("widuu", rune('w'))) //0
}


9.func IndexFunc(s string, f func(rune) bool) int這個函數大家一看就知道了,是通過類型的轉換來用函數查找位置,我們來代碼看下哈

復制代碼 代碼如下:

import (
 "fmt"
 "strings"
)

func main() {
 fmt.Println(strings.IndexFunc("nihaoma", split)) //3
}

func split(r rune) bool {
 if r == 'a' {
  return true
 }
 return false
}


10.func LastIndex(s, sep string) int 看到這個大家可能也明白了查找的是最后出現的位置,正好跟index相反

復制代碼 代碼如下:

import (
 "fmt"
 "strings"
)

func main() {
 fmt.Println(strings.LastIndex("widuu", "u")) // 4
}


11.func LastIndexAny(s, chars string) int這個跟indexAny正好相反,也是查找最后一個

復制代碼 代碼如下:

import (
 "fmt"
 "strings"
)

func main() {
 fmt.Println(strings.LastIndexAny("widuu", "u")) // 4
}


您可能感興趣的文章:
  • Golang編程實現刪除字符串中出現次數最少字符的方法
  • go浮點數轉字符串保留小數點后N位的完美解決方法
  • Go語言中的字符串處理方法示例詳解
  • Golang字符串的拼接方法匯總
  • Golang實現字符串倒序的幾種解決方案
  • Golang使用zlib壓縮和解壓縮字符串
  • Go語言編程中字符串切割方法小結
  • 使用go實現刪除sql里面的注釋和字符串功能(demo)

標簽:眉山 邢臺 紹興 七臺河 雅安 宜昌 上海 盤錦

巨人網絡通訊聲明:本文標題《Go語言中字符串的查找方法小結》,本文關鍵詞  語,言中,字符串,的,查找,;如發現本文內容存在版權問題,煩請提供相關信息告之我們,我們將及時溝通與處理。本站內容系統采集于網絡,涉及言論、版權與本站無關。
  • 相關文章
  • 下面列出與本文章《Go語言中字符串的查找方法小結》相關的同類信息!
  • 本頁收集關于Go語言中字符串的查找方法小結的相關信息資訊供網民參考!
  • 推薦文章
    婷婷综合国产,91蜜桃婷婷狠狠久久综合9色 ,九九九九九精品,国产综合av
    免费观看在线综合| 蜜臀av性久久久久蜜臀aⅴ流畅| av一本久道久久综合久久鬼色| 日本成人超碰在线观看| 亚洲国产精品一区二区www| 中文成人av在线| 欧美国产精品专区| 中文字幕日韩av资源站| 亚洲综合激情另类小说区| 亚洲国产毛片aaaaa无费看 | 成人aaaa免费全部观看| 欧美国产精品久久| 日韩三级视频中文字幕| 777欧美精品| 欧美日韩精品欧美日韩精品一| 欧美曰成人黄网| 欧美日本韩国一区二区三区视频 | 99久久久久免费精品国产 | 成人激情动漫在线观看| 国产mv日韩mv欧美| 美洲天堂一区二卡三卡四卡视频| 在线观看国产精品网站| 久久影院视频免费| 国产99一区视频免费| 欧美一区二区三区四区久久| 亚洲精品va在线观看| 91精品福利视频| 亚洲视频 欧洲视频| av成人动漫在线观看| 成人午夜激情在线| 丰满岳乱妇一区二区三区| 黑人巨大精品欧美黑白配亚洲| 久久er精品视频| 国产.欧美.日韩| 色偷偷一区二区三区| 精品一区二区在线播放| 狠狠色丁香婷婷综合久久片| 日韩欧美123| 国产一区二区视频在线播放| 国产精品日产欧美久久久久| 亚洲欧美激情在线| 亚洲1区2区3区4区| 日韩精品每日更新| 久久99久久久欧美国产| 99精品热视频| 日韩欧美中文一区二区| 国产精品久久久久久户外露出| 亚洲一区在线观看视频| 国产成人高清在线| 欧美精品久久一区| 一区二区中文视频| 精品亚洲国内自在自线福利| 成人免费视频caoporn| 欧美日韩国产经典色站一区二区三区 | 91精品麻豆日日躁夜夜躁| 亚洲女爱视频在线| 日本欧美韩国一区三区| 紧缚奴在线一区二区三区| heyzo一本久久综合| 久久综合色鬼综合色| 视频一区中文字幕国产| 91天堂素人约啪| 2023国产精品自拍| 亚洲天天做日日做天天谢日日欢 | 国产不卡在线一区| 91精品欧美福利在线观看| 亚洲免费观看高清| 成人天堂资源www在线| 日韩午夜激情视频| 亚洲一区在线观看视频| 国产精品夜夜爽| 精品国产凹凸成av人导航| 色综合久久天天| 国产真实精品久久二三区| 伊人一区二区三区| 91在线国产观看| 最新国产精品久久精品| fc2成人免费人成在线观看播放| 国产精品久久影院| 国产很黄免费观看久久| 久久免费精品国产久精品久久久久| 亚洲成av人片在线观看| 欧洲另类一二三四区| 97se亚洲国产综合自在线不卡| 久久久久久9999| 国产精品中文字幕一区二区三区| 日韩天堂在线观看| 国产欧美一区二区精品性色| 欧美日韩国产成人在线免费| av中文字幕亚洲| 国产不卡一区视频| 亚洲一区视频在线| 欧美三级电影网站| 国产a精品视频| 成人高清免费在线播放| 国产不卡一区视频| 亚洲女人小视频在线观看| 91首页免费视频| 有码一区二区三区| 欧美欧美欧美欧美首页| 一区二区三区视频在线观看| av中文字幕亚洲| 亚洲免费大片在线观看| 欧美日精品一区视频| 欧美aaaaa成人免费观看视频| 精品国产乱码久久久久久久久| 黄页视频在线91| 一区二区三区四区高清精品免费观看| 99久久伊人网影院| 亚洲动漫第一页| 日韩欧美精品在线视频| 国产精品中文欧美| 一区二区欧美在线观看| 91精品国产综合久久福利| 国产·精品毛片| 亚洲一区中文在线| 国产精品热久久久久夜色精品三区 | 国产美女在线精品| 国产日韩欧美不卡在线| 亚洲高清免费视频| 久久综合网色—综合色88| aaa亚洲精品| 美女一区二区久久| 亚洲欧美日韩国产综合| 欧美电影免费提供在线观看| 国产美女娇喘av呻吟久久| 椎名由奈av一区二区三区| 国产亚洲精品资源在线26u| 欧美日韩免费一区二区三区| 大白屁股一区二区视频| 无码av免费一区二区三区试看| 国产乱码精品一品二品| 亚洲成在人线免费| 亚洲v精品v日韩v欧美v专区| 欧美精品自拍偷拍| 国产日韩欧美激情| 欧美少妇xxx| 99久久99久久综合| 国产精品一区在线观看你懂的| 在线观看视频一区二区| 成人性生交大片免费看中文网站| 天天色综合成人网| 亚洲第一激情av| 一区二区三区欧美| 国产精品青草综合久久久久99| 91精品国产色综合久久不卡蜜臀 | 一区二区在线免费| 国产清纯美女被跳蛋高潮一区二区久久w| 欧美丰满少妇xxxxx高潮对白| 97se亚洲国产综合自在线观| 韩国精品免费视频| 日本视频免费一区| 亚洲男人天堂一区| 欧美日韩免费观看一区二区三区| 国产精品一二三| 美脚の诱脚舐め脚责91| 日韩有码一区二区三区| 成人欧美一区二区三区白人| www国产精品av| 精品成人在线观看| 欧美日韩国产成人在线免费| 欧美亚洲动漫精品| 欧美视频一区二区三区| 一本色道久久加勒比精品 | 成人免费电影视频| 国产成人精品亚洲午夜麻豆| 91国内精品野花午夜精品| av成人动漫在线观看| 91福利国产成人精品照片| jizzjizzjizz欧美| 91免费视频大全| 三级不卡在线观看| 国产一区二区三区在线看麻豆| 床上的激情91.| 色94色欧美sute亚洲线路一ni | 亚洲精品视频在线| 免费人成黄页网站在线一区二区| 精品亚洲成a人| 在线观看www91| 欧美一区午夜视频在线观看| 亚洲国产精品精华液ab| 免费高清在线一区| 国产成人精品综合在线观看| 日韩午夜av电影| 亚洲精品日韩综合观看成人91| 国内精品免费**视频| 色婷婷av一区| 精品第一国产综合精品aⅴ| 亚洲伊人伊色伊影伊综合网| 国产真实乱子伦精品视频| 成人97人人超碰人人99| 制服视频三区第一页精品| 综合久久综合久久| 精品一区二区三区的国产在线播放| 丁香婷婷综合色啪| 日韩欧美国产小视频| 国产欧美日韩亚州综合| 亚洲一区二区三区四区的| 亚洲国产成人91porn| 亚洲国产一二三|